Which country has the fastest high-speed train?
217 views
China operates the world's fastest high-speed train, the Shanghai Maglev. This commercial maglev system represents the pinnacle of rail technology, capable of remarkable speeds. China also boasts other top-tier trains like the CRH380A and China Railway Fuxing.
